Justin Timberlake to honor Madonna at Rock and Roll Hall of Fame induction

The Rock and Roll Hall of Fame Foundation has announced the artists who will induct this year’s honorees at a ceremony on March 10th, at the Waldorf-Astoria Hotel in New York City.
During the ceremony Leonard Cohen will be inducted by Lou Reed. The Dave Clark Five (Dave Clark, Lenny Davidson, Rick Huxley, Denis Payton and Mike Smith) will be inducted by Tom Hanks. Madonna will be inducted by Justin Timberlake.
John Mellencamp will be inducted by Billy Joel. Kenny Gamble and Leon Huff will be inducted by Jerry Butler. The Ventures (Bob Bogle, Nokie Edwards, Gerry McGee, Mel Taylor, Don Wilson) will be inducted by John Fogerty. Little Walter will be inducted by Ben Harper.
The 2008 Rock and Roll Hall of Fame inductees were chosen by the 600 voters of the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ame Foundation. Artists are eligible for inclusion in the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ame 25 years after their first recording is released.
John Mellencamp and The Ventures are among the artists slated to perform at the event.
In addition to being honored at the ceremony on March 10, 2008, each artist who is inducted is commemorated within the I.M. Pei-designed museum in Cleveland, Ohio.
The Rock and Roll Hall of Fame displays the signature of each inductee inscribed in glass. In addition, there is an exhibit of artifacts from this year’s inductees, and a multi-media film presentation with highlights from each artist’s career.
The exhibit on this year’s inductees will open in March, 2008 and will run for one year.
